Running slightly late, as usual, I arrived at the entrance of The Andaz Liverpool Street's 1901 Restaurant with my accomplice for the evening.


"Just this way madame..."

Now I'll let you into a little secret  but you've got to promise me you'll keep it to yourself! Deal? 

On the last Wednesday of every month, The 1901 restaurant becomes transformed with a sea of romantic candles that'll guarantee to give you that breathtaking moment with your loved one...



See what I mean? Stunning.


Gasps and Fluttery hearts later- we were seated. Hours of conversation, pondering over the extensive 350 bottle long wine list [ The 2010 Châteauneuf-du-Pape ‘Réserve’ will not disappoint] and oggling at the incredibly talented saxaphone player- we were ready to order. 

The menu is fabulous. Straight, to the point, no airs and graces- tell me what's in it so I can devour it [in a romantic, elegant and orderly fashion so not to appear anything less to my date ofcourse!] 

Crab for Starters and Beef Fillet for mains- it all sounded relatively simple... [ Mandatory Disclaimer- mood lighting is fabulous for the ambience not so much for the pictures...]




But don't let that fool you ladies and gentlemen, what arrives to your plate is a host of well thought out flavours and presentations that will undoubtedly be sure to leave you securing a reservation for your next visit before you even step a foot out of the door.

Struggling to breathe we scoured the dessert menu before deciding it wouldn't be as romantic to be rolled out of the restaurant [I'll most definitely start with dessert the next time- I had a pang of food envy from the table next to me as the dessert looked incredible!] 

Filled with what can only be described as wonderful memories from a lovely evening [well that and oodles of Mash Potatoes]- we were floored by the excellent food and service at 1901.
